   There is nothing the matter with Americans except their ideals. The real American is all right; it is the ideal American who is all wrong.  Nice Word by G.K. Chesterton

   The American Revolution was a beginning, not a consummation.  Meaningful Quotation by Woodrow Wilson

   The winds that blow through the wide sky in these mounts, the winds that sweep from Canada to Mexico, from the Pacific to the Atlantic - have always blown on free men.  Good Quote by Franklin D. Roosevelt

   We cannot reform the world.... Uncle Sugar is as dangerous a role for us to play as Uncle Shylock.  Wise Phrase by John F. Kennedy

   The fact is that Americans are not a thoughtful people; they are too busy to stop and question their values.  Wise Phrase by William Ralph

   Intellectually I know that America is no better than any other country; emotionally I know she is better than every other country.  Famous Saying by Sinclair Lewis

   We're Americans - with a capital A! And do you know what that means? Do you? It means that our forefathers were kicked out of every decent country in the world.  Nice Word by From the movie Stripes

   Only Americans can hurt America.  Meaningful Quotation by Dwight D. Eisenhower

   It is a pity that instead of the Pilgrim Fathers landing on Plymouth Rock, Plymouth Rock had not landed on the Pilgrim Fathers.  Good Quote by Chauncey Depew, at an 1881 New England Society meeting in New York

   If America ever passes out as a great nation, we ought to put on our tombstone: America died from a delusion she had Moral Leadership.  Wise Phrase by Will Rogers

   I just don't know why they're shooting at us. All we want to do is bring them democracy and white bread. Transplant the American dream. Freedom. Achievement. Hyperacidity. Affluence. Flatulence. Technology. Tension. The inalienable right to an early coronary sitting at your desk while plotting to stab your boss in the back.  Wise Phrase by Hawkeye, M*A*S*H, O.R.

   When an American says that he loves his country, he means not only that he loves the New England hills, the prairies glistening in the sun, the wide and rising plains, the great mountains, and the sea. He means that he loves an inner air, an inner light in which freedom lives and in which a man can draw the breath of self-respect.  Famous Saying by Adlai Stevenson

   You cannot spill a drop of American blood without spilling the blood of the whole world.... We are not a nation, so much as a world.  Nice Word by Herman Melville

   There is nothing wrong with America that cannot be cured by what is right with America.  Meaningful Quotation by William J. Clinton

   Americans always try to do the right thing after they've tried everything else.  Good Quote by Winston Churchill

   Let America realize that self-scrutiny is not treason. Self-examination is not disloyalty.  Wise Phrase by Richard Cardinal Cushing

   Perhaps, after all, America never has been discovered. I myself would say that it had merely been detected.  Wise Phrase by Oscar Wilde

   America makes prodigious mistakes, America has colossal faults, but one thing cannot be denied: America is always on the move. She may be going to Hell, of course, but at least she isn't standing still.  Famous Saying by e.e. cummings

   America is a vast conspiracy to make you happy.  Nice Word by John Updike

   America is the only country ever founded on the printed word.  Meaningful Quotation by Marshall McLuhan

   I hate American simplicity. I glory in the piling up of complications of every sort. If I could pronounce the name James in any different or more elaborate way I should be in favor of doing it.  Good Quote by Henry James

   America did not invent human rights. In a very real sense... human rights invented America.  Wise Phrase by Jimmy Carter

   We have the Bill of Rights. What we need is a Bill of Responsibilities.  Wise Phrase by Bill Maher

   This country will not be a good place for any of us to live in unless we make it a good place for all of us to live in.  Famous Saying by Theodore Roosevelt

   ...a land of the free that struggles under the incredible burden of limitless taxes and laws; the home of the brave who stay silent to keep their jobs and avoid scrutiny by the IRS or the police.  Nice Word by Fred Woodworth, The Match!, No. 74
